Radiohead Eliminates Freebies With New 'Newspaper' Album

You'll be able to purchase digital copies online (for a set price this time) on February 19th. Physical editions, reportedly packed with artwork and other "goodies," will start shipping out on March 9th. Basic digital downloads will reportedly run around $10, while the loaded physical packages will cost approximately $50. The band hasn't specifically addressed what exactly constitutes a "newspaper album," but "the world's first"? Ian Anderson and his Jethro Tull bandmates might have a little something to say about that.
